NextJS基础教程
2024-10-16 15:21:26 作者:石家庄人才网
石家庄人才网今天给大家分享《NextJS基础教程》,石家庄人才网小编对内容进行了深度展开编辑,希望通过本文能为您带来解惑。
Next.js 是一个基于 React 的服务端渲染框架,它可以帮助开发者构建高性能、SEO 友好的 Web 应用程序。以下是 Next.js 的基础教程,涵盖了从安装到部署的基本概念和步骤。
1. 安装
首先,你需要安装 Node.js 和 npm。然后,你可以使用以下命令创建一个新的 Next.js 项目:
```npx create-next-app my-next-app```这将创建一个名为 "my-next-app" 的新目录,并在其中安装 Next.js 和所有必要的依赖项。
2. 页面和路由
在 Next.js 中,页面是 React 组件,它们位于 "pages" 目录下。例如,"pages/index.js" 文件将成为你的网站的首页。Next.js 使用基于文件的路由系统,这意味着你的 URL 结构将与你的文件结构相匹配。石家庄人才网小编提醒您,例如,"pages/about.js" 文件将对应于 "/about" 路由。3. 数据获取
Next.js 提供了几种方法来获取页面数据:
- getStaticProps: 此函数在构建时运行,并允许你预渲染页面,使其具有快速的初始加载时间。
- getServerSideProps: 此函数在每个请求上运行,并允许你获取动态数据。
- SWR: 这是一个用于数据获取和缓存的 React Hooks 库。
4. 样式和布局
Next.js 支持多种样式和布局选项:
- CSS Modules: 这是一种将 CSS 样式封装到组件中的方法。
- Sass/SCSS: 你可以使用预处理器来编写更易于维护的 CSS。
- Styled-JSX: 这是一种使用 JavaScript 编写 CSS 的方法。
5. 部署
你可以将 Next.js 应用程序部署到各种平台,包括 Vercel、Netlify 和 AWS。Next.js 还提供了内置的优化功能,例如自动代码拆分和图像优化,以帮助你构建高性能的应用程序。石家庄人才网小编认为,这些优化功能可以有效提升用户体验。
有关《NextJS基础教程》的内容介绍到这里,想要了解更多相关内容记得收藏关注本站。
- 上一篇:前端网页设计用什么软件
- 下一篇:返回列表
版权声明:《NextJS基础教程》来自【石家庄人才网】收集整理于网络,不代表本站立场,所有图片文章版权属于原作者,如有侵略,联系删除。
https://www.ymil.cn/quanzi/15710.html